Abstract
As the deployment of wavelength-division multiplexing (WDM) transmission fa cilities speeds up, the next step is to add cross-connects to route WDM sig nals, Electro-optical directional couplers (DCs) are well suited for the ta sk since they can pass WDM signals, However, DCs suffer an intrinsic crosst alk problem. Removing crosstalk has been an important design issue. In this paper, we show how to take advantage of the multiple-wavelength characteri stic of a WDM signal to reduce crosstalk in a DC-hased photonic switching s ystem.
